
Michael Charles Parker, 71, of Lizton, went to be with the Lord on March 11, 2017. He was born on February 21, 1946 in Indianapolis to Mora and Issabell Parker. He graduated from George Washington High School in 1965. Mike served his country in the US Army, having served in Vietnam.
He retired from Praxair in Speedway. Mike loved to exercise, take walks, and watch tv. He loved to spend time with his family.
Mike is survived by his wife of 50 years, Flora; his children, Michael S. Parker and Kristina (Jeff) VanHook; grandchildren, Cassidy and Samuel Parker; sisters, Jeanie Gutierrez, Laura Parker, and Tina Mendenhall; and many other family members and friends. He was preceded in death by his grandson, Jackson VanHook; sister, Diana Patton; and brothers, Frank Parker and Mora D. Parker, Jr.
No services will be held. Memorial donations may be made in Mike’s name to the Michael J. Fox Foundation (www.michaeljfox.org/donate).
